Pineda Tacos

Pineda Tacos
311 E. Lake St. Minneapolis

I stopped in at Pineda Tacos on E. Lake on a whim, and because it smelled delicious. I'd also heard they had great tacos. When you walk in, you see trays of different meats that can be used in tacos or burritos. It looks like a much less slick and streamlined Chipotle. I'll be honest and admit I had no idea what some of this stuff was. I ordered a couple of chicken tacos. They have 3 types of chicken to choose from, a spicy chicken, a mild chicken and a chicken in verde sauce. I chose one spicy and one mild.

The tacos are wrapped up in double corn tortillas (you can choose flour if you wish), which really helps because the chicken is marinated and juicy, which softens the tortilla and tends to make it fall apart. The gentleman at the counter asked if I wanted everything, which ended up being onions, cilantro and salsa.

First I tried the spicy chicken. It was a bit warm but nothing overwhelming. I'm actually kind of a wimp. so if you are one who likes hot spicy hot, you might need some hot sauce on this. It was tasty though. As good as that was, the mild chicken is where it's at, for me. The chicken was tender and juicy, the marinade/sauce was flavorful. With the onions and the cilantro the whole thing was very light and fresh tasting. Even my friend and taste testing buddy, who LOVES spicy food, preferred the mild chicken.

I'll definitely be heading back to Pineda Tacos. Next time I plan on having more time to inquire about the other meats on the line, and to try something different. If you want a good taco that is not overdone, this is the place.
